Where is the Thraser family from?

You can see how Thraser families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Thraser family name was found in the USA, and the UK between 1880 and 1920. The most Thraser families were found in USA in 1880. In 1880 there were 8 Thraser families living in Alabama. This was about 42% of all the recorded Thraser's in USA. Alabama had the highest population of Thraser families in 1880.

What is the average Thraser lifespan?

Average Thraser life expectancy in 1990 was 77 years. This was higher than the general public life expectancy which was 74.

An unusually short lifespan might indicate that your Thraser ancestors lived in harsh conditions. A short lifespan might also indicate health problems that were once prevalent in your family.
